Blood in Sputum: You need to be checked. Blood in sputum can be a sign of cancer, & you are at increased risk because you smoke.

Needs evaluation: If you have been smoking a long time, congratulations on stopping. But if you have abnormal sputum, especially with blood in it, you need an evaluation. While it might just be some type of bronchitis which can improve now that smoking has stopped, it might be some other condition that you need help with. Start with your family doctor and follow his advice.
